New Delhi: The Income Tax Department on Saturday further extended the deadline for filing income tax return (ITR) for the 2019-20 Financial Year to November 30.
The department tweeted that the decision was taken “understanding and keeping in mind the times that we are in” and hoped it will help taxpayers “plan things better”.
On Thursday, the I-T department had also extended the deadline for claiming deductions under tax saving investments/payments for the 2019-20 FY to July 31.
